How to Measure

Bust
Fullest Part of Bust
Wrap the tape around the fullest part of your bust, keeping it level across your back. Let the tape rest comfortably against your body without pulling it tight.
Waist
Natural Waistline
Measure around the narrowest part of your torso. If you are unsure where that is, bend gently to one side and measure where your body naturally creases.
Hips
Fullest Part of Hips
Stand with your feet together and measure around the fullest part of your hips and seat. Keep the tape level without pulling it tight.
Inseam
Inside Leg
Measure from the top of your inner leg to your preferred hem length. A favorite pair of pants can also provide a helpful comparison.

Start With the Bust

For tops and dresses, the bust is often the best starting point, especially when the style is structured or designed to fit closer to the body.

Consider the Shape

Relaxed, boxy, fitted, and oversized describe different intended silhouettes. Read The Full Picture before changing from your usual size.

Check the Length

Compare the listed length with a similar top or dress you own, particularly when shopping cropped, tunic, mini, midi, or maxi styles.

Between sizes? Use the measurement most important to the garment’s shape and follow the product-specific fit recommendation. Do not automatically size up or down unless the available information supports it.

Compare Waist and Hips

Review both measurements. The better starting point depends on the waistband, rise, cut, fabric, stretch, and intended fit of the particular style.

Look at the Rise

Low, mid, and high rises sit differently on the body. Compare the listed rise with a pair you already own when that measurement is available.

Check the Inseam

Inseams vary by style. Always review the product measurement when available, especially for cropped, ankle, flare, and wide-leg silhouettes.

A note on denim: Stretch, recovery, rise, and cut can change how denim fits. Follow the sizing guidance provided for that specific pair, including any maker-specific denim sizing.

One-Piece Styles

For jumpsuits and rompers, compare bust, waist, and hips. Torso length and rise can also affect comfort when those measurements are available.

Activewear

Activewear can range from softly relaxed to compressive. Use the verified stretch and fit notes for the individual piece rather than assuming it will fit close.

Coordinated Sets

Consider how both pieces need to fit. If the top and bottom suit you differently, use the product measurements and choose for the area with less flexibility.

Choose for your comfort: Your preferred fit matters. Review The Full Picture for the intended silhouette and any verified recommendation before selecting a different size.

Compare With a Favorite

Lay It Flat

Choose a similar garment that fits the way you like. Lay it on a flat surface without stretching it, then compare its measurements with How It Measures on the product page.

Use the Same Method

Some makers provide flat measurements while others provide full garment measurements. Compare numbers only when they were taken using the same method.

Product-specific fit information should always take priority over general sizing guidance.
